Network grows service capabilities in Switzerland

29 March, 2022

Baker Tilly in Switzerland has extended its service capabilities with two new firms joining its group. 

Zurich-based Budliger AG has around 40 employees delivering tax, audit, accounting, business consultancy, human resources and inheritance law services to the SME market.

The acquisition of Berne-based Abacus specialist WYMAG Consulting AG further solidifies Baker Tilly’s position as the leading Abacus Gold Partner in Switzerland.

Speaking on the acquisitions, Thomas Zueger, Managing Partner in Baker Tilly in Switzerland said: “I am delighted to welcome Budlinger AG and WYMAG Consulting AG to our group. Our shared vision and purpose make them the perfect fit as we continue to strengthen our capabilities to ensure we are the confident choice for our clients.”

Xavier Mercadé Sanmartí, the network’s Regional Chairman for Europe, Middle East and Africa added: “Switzerland’s economy is one of the world’s most advanced and highly-developed free-market economies. These acquisitions strengthen our ability to deliver services consistently and with quality assurance as we focus on ensuring clients are positioned now to seize tomorrow’s opportunities.”
